El Salvador Continues to Double Down on its Bitcoin Strategy
Back in the year 2021, El Salvador made headlines when it became the first country to make Bitcoin legal tender. It is reported that El Salvador under the leadership of Nayib Bukele has since then continued pushing for more Bitcoin with the country's president Nayib Bukele buying big amounts of the crypto.
As per a report, Bukele in the mid November said that he will begin buying 1 Bitcoin per day from November 18. As of now reportedly the country is said to have around 2,381 Bitcoin.

Bukele's move towards Bitcoin is something being praised by the crypto industry but on the other hand criticized by international institutions like International Monetary Fund (IMF) and World Bank.
Not to forget, Bukele also created a National Bitcoin Office in the country in late 2022 in conjunction with Stacy Herbert and Max Keiser who are said to be the known Bitcoiners.
Remittances from overseas based Salvadorans are reported to be a main source of income but reportedly crypto accounts for less than 2% of all the remittances made to the country.
The reason might probably be because of the stance of a country like United States towards cryptocurrency which ain't much favorable for the industry and also no clear regulations across the globe. And it might also be because of the crypto market struggling for some time now with the prices of most of the cryptocurrencies dipped down including Bitcoin.
